Farmers and industry experts gathered in Moultrie, Georgia last week for the Sunbelt Ag Expo Field Day. Helena Agri-Enterprises is conducting a trial on potassium products this year at the Sunbelt Ag Expo’s Darrell Williams Research Farm. Following five years of data collection from thousands of samples they found 68% of the cotton samples they studied to be deficient in potassium. Southeast AgNet visited with Eli Croley from Helena Agri-Enterprises to discuss the importance of potassium to your cotton crop.
